Using Substructure for contact modelling

Using Substructure for contact modelling

Using Substructure for contact modelling

(OP)
Hello Friends,

I have used this forum many times to get my doubts solved. I have a problem to use substructure for contact anaylsis of two gears. I have already read the example in abaqus Example problem manual for help. Well, to explain my problem in detail, I have two nastron files of two gears and later using FORTRAN I am able to write the programm to generate the *.inp files. What I tried to do is
1. Substrcture generation of two gears in seperate files. Now I have two sets of substructures available for individual gears. While generating the substruture, I have retained the DOF for the nodes which are on the flanks because I wish to use these nodes to write the conatact between two gears.

2. In another file, I write down the nodes and elements only related to the flanks of the gears OR the retained nodes. Now comes the tricky part, I have used till now different type of combinations to write the elements but I could not do it successfully till now. Every time, I recieve a different error. The combinations I have tried to use for writing the surfaces for contact are:
a. Both the elements are written using surface elemtns like SFM3D8, so an element based surface to write the contact between two gears.
b. Both the elements are written using membrane elements like M3D8, so an element based surface to write the contact between two gears.
c. One surface is used with SFM3D8 elements and another is used with node based surface to define contact between two gears.
d. Only one gear is used for substructre generation and other gear is kept as it is with original C3D20 elements. So for one gear the surface is written as element based surface and for another gear it is written as node based surface.
If anyone has worked with a similar problem, it would be really grateful if someone can suggest something about it. Also if someone has any clue about the follwing errors I am getting during the simulation, they can please reply me with the root cause of the error. The errors are:
1. The volume proportional damping factor could not be calculated.
2. Too many attempts made for this increment.
3. The static stabilization factor could not be calculated.

If someone is interested in going through the files, I can upload them and thank you in advance for help.
